Huawei announces foldable Mate X’s successor

Huawei Mate X is due to retail in November. Mate Xs is initially scheduled to launch in China in March 2020.

Huawei Mate X hasn’t even hit markets yet, the Chinese technological giant has already unveiled its successor during an event in Shenzhen where it announced the Mate 30 5G and Mate 30 Pro 5G for the local market.

The device is named as Mate Xs, which has a major upgrade in the chipset which is Huawei's latest Kirin 990, instead of the 980 which featured in the Mate X.

Apart from the chipset, there is not official update available for Mate Xs specs so we’ll have to wait for more details in the coming months. By judging the rumors we can expect that it could have the same camera setup as Huawei's P30 Pro.

In terms of design, the Mate Xs is quite identical to the Mate X. The device is only set to launch in China at this moment – but it's actually possible it'll launch globally instead of the Mate X.

The Mate Xs release date is March 2020 in China, and it'll likely launch there before anywhere else.
